Workforce Training for Underserved Healthcare Sectors
In recent years, the healthcare landscape has continued to evolve, driven by the urgent need for accessible and culturally competent care. This funding initiative specifically addresses the workforce development challenges faced by underserved communities in the healthcare sector. It supports the development of comprehensive training modules tailored for in-demand health occupations, such as medical assistants and community health workers, with the ultimate goal of creating pathways for underrepresented individuals to enter and thrive in the healthcare profession. This funding does not extend to funding direct service delivery but focuses instead on educational and workforce training infrastructure necessary for these roles.
To illustrate the impact of this funding, consider the case of a community health center in an urban area. By applying for this grant, the center was able to design a training program that included both classroom instruction and hands-on experience in real clinic settings. The program targeted unemployed youth from nearby neighborhoods, aiming to provide them with the skills and certifications necessary to secure employment as medical assistants. Upon completion, participants not only received job placements but also contributed to the center's mission of delivering high-quality primary care in a culturally relevant manner.
Another example can be seen in rural communities, where healthcare access is limited. A collaborative initiative between a local educational institution and healthcare providers was funded through this grant to create a pipeline program. This program involved summer internships for high school students interested in pursuing health careers, allowing them to gain practical experience while still in school. The internships not only sparked interest in health professions but also prepared participants for future roles in their communities, where healthcare professionals are often in short supply.
Who should apply for this funding? Organizations deeply engaged in workforce development and training for healthcare-related occupations are ideal candidates. This may include vocational schools, community colleges, healthcare providers, or non-profits dedicated to improving health access through workforce initiatives. On the other hand, organizations focused solely on direct healthcare delivery or research without an educational or training component may not fit within the funding criteria.
The alignment factors for successful applicants include a clear understanding of local healthcare needs, established partnerships with local employers, and a commitment to supporting underrepresented populations. Grant proposals should illustrate a robust plan for measuring success and tracking employment outcomes, demonstrating how the funding will lead to sustainable job placements in the healthcare field. Additionally, an ongoing commitment to adapting training programs based on workforce trends will further enhance the effectiveness of the initiatives supported by this funding.
